World Cup favourites Brazil were knocked out of the tournament on penalties by Croatia.

Neymar had given Brazil the lead in the first-half of extra time, before Croatia struck back.

The game ended 1-1 after 120 minutes but Brazil came up short in the shoot-out, with two misses to go out 4-2. Neymar did not even take a penalty and was seen in tears after the game had finished.

Brazil World Cup 2022 squad

Goalkeepers: Alisson, Ederson, Weverton

Defenders: Alex Sandro, Alex Telles, Dani Alves, Danilo, Bremer, Eder Militao, Marquinhos, Thiago Silva

Midfielders: Bruno Guimaraes, Casemiro, Everton Ribeiro, Fabinho, Fred, Lucas Paqueta

Forwards: Antony, Gabriel Jesus, Gabriel Martinelli, Neymar Jr., Pedro, Raphinha, Richarlison, Rodrygo, Vinicius Jr.

Group G

November 24: Brazil 2 Serbia 0

November 28: Brazil 1 Switzerland 0

December 2: Cameroon 1 Brazil 0

Last 16

December 5: Brazil 4 South Korea 1

Quarter-finals

December 9: Brazil 1 Croatia 1 (Croatia win 4-2 on penalties)

What is Brazil’s World Cup record?

Brazil are the most successful team in the tournament’s history. They’ve won the World Cup a record five times (1958, 1962, 1970, 1994, 2002) and have played in all 21 editions of the tournament so far.

At Russia 2018, Brazil were tournament favourites but crashed out at the quarter-final stage following a 2-1 defeat to Belgium.
